Song Analysis for I Can Be Your Mother

"I Can Be Your Mother" is a haunting exploration of womanhood, power dynamics, and the exhausting expectations placed upon women in relationships and society. At its core, the song dissects the performative nature of femininity, highlighting how women are often required to shape-shift to fulfill the contradictory desires of those around them. The lyrics delve into the disturbing and visceral realities of this existence, exposing the psychological toll of constantly adapting to be what others need—whether that is a nurturing mother, a submissive lover, a pristine virgin, or a disposable object.

The central message revolves around autonomy and defiance within a patriarchal structure. While the narrator willingly lists an extreme array of roles she can play for her partner—blurring the lines between comfort and violence, reality and illusion—she draws a definitive line at ownership. The recurring climax of the song, where she declares she could be "anything, anything, anything but yours," serves as a powerful reclamation of her agency. She is willing to engage in the chaotic theater of their relationship, but she refuses to be possessed or consumed by it.

Implicitly, the song critiques the historical and cultural "Madonna-whore complex," forcing the listener to confront how society categorizes women into extreme, unrealistic archetypes. The lyrics also touch upon the conflict between romantic submission and the pursuit of artistic success, as the narrator grapples with which force will ultimately "rule" her. The overarching narrative is one of survival, grotesque transformation, and the fierce preservation of the self in a world that constantly demands women to surrender their identities.
